PROJECT TITLE :

Bumpless Control for Reduced THD in Power Factor Correction Circuits - 2016

ABSTRACT:

It's well known that power issue correction (PFC) circuits suffer from 2 fundamentally totally different operating modes over a given AC input cycle. These 2 modes, continuous conduction mode (CCM) and discontinuous conduction mode (DCM), have very totally different frequency-response characteristics that may create control design for PFC circuits difficult. The drawback is exacerbated by tries to improve potency by dynamically adjusting the PWM switching frequency based on the load. Adjusting the PWM frequency primarily based on the load limits controller bandwidth and restricts dynamic performance. Prior work has made use of multiple controllers, but, they need not addressed the discontinuity (bump) that exists when switching between controllers. During this paper, bumpless controllers will be synthesized for a 750 watt, semi-bridgeless PFC for the CCM-DCM operating modes.
